Common Window Problems Addressed by Certified Window Doctors
Licensed Window Doctors are trained to identify and deal with numerous window-related issues. Here are some typical problems they deal with:
- Drafts and Air Leaks: Inefficient seals can lead to considerable air leaks, increasing energy expenses.
- Condensation and Fogging: Insulated windows can develop condensation in between panes, indicating seal failure.
- Broken or Cracked Glass: Damaged glass can jeopardize security and energy performance.
- Hardware Issues: Problems with locks, hinges, or other parts can impact safety and performance.
- Window Frame Rot: Wooden frames can deteriorate gradually, leading to structural issues.
- Improper Installation: Poorly installed windows can cause numerous problems, including water leaks and inadequate insulation.

Frequently Asked Question About Certified Window Doctors
1. What qualifications should I search for in a Certified Window Doctor?
Look for certifications from acknowledged companies, licenses, insurance coverage, and good standing with local structure authorities.
2. How can I tell if my windows need repair or replacement?
Indications consist of noticeable damage, trouble opening or closing, drafts, and condensation in between panes. An expert can perform an extensive inspection.
3. How typically should I have my windows examined?
It's suggested to have your windows inspected a minimum of once a year to catch small problems before they escalate.
4. Are the services of a Certified Window Doctor expensive?
Expenses can differ based on service type and window condition. However, buying licensed services can save money in the long run through energy performance and enhanced home value.
5. Is DIY window repair safe?
While some small repairs may be tried by property owners, professional examination is important for complicated issues to make sure security and effectiveness.
